ABOUT THE ARTWORK
Featuring Mount Rainier, this mosaic panel is the largest element to the Bloom Where You're Planted! series. Mosaics are artist Reham Aarti's favorite metaphors for life, who notes that "to create beauty from the broken and discarded allows us to see things with new eyes." The series also includes mosaic art on the concrete benches and planters outside of the school and in the library.
This artwork was acquired for the State Art Collection in partnership with Bethel School District.
ABOUT THE ARTIST
Reham Aarti creates mosaics for public places. She works primarily with glass, plus a variety of other materials. Aarti says, “working in mosaics gives me a daily reminder of the triumph of the human spirit.”
Aarti has taught mosaic classes for a variety of ages, including adult mosaic classes for cancer survivors and caregivers at St. Alphonsus Hospital in Boise. She grew up in Kuwait and now lives in Boise, Idaho.
